
ENKA, within the framework of the construction of Nizhnekamsk 495 MW Combined Cycle Power Plant, has fully completed its mobilization activities and current rate of progress on construction works reached 31.5% as of 31 December 2019.
Commodities purchasing is 60% complete and 2x gas turbines with uxiliaries, steam turbine with auxiliaries, condenser, 3 x Generators, 2 x HRSGs with auxiliaries and 3 x GSU transformers delivered to site.
The major site accomplishments of project include 2 x Gas Turbine, 1 x Steam Turbine, 3 x Generators, Condenser and 3 x Step Up Transformers placement on foundation, 2 x HRSGs steel erection and 12 Modules installation (2,400 tons for 2 HRSGs), 175 tons UG steel pipe installation. Furthermore, 4 Major Buildings and Cooling Tower construction works are ongoing and within the project scope 21,300 m³ of concrete pouring, 3,400 tons of structural steel erection, 12,000 m² of sandwich panel installation have been completed.
Meanwhile, the detail design works are ongoing and a progress rate of 80% has been achieved.
